Auckland's dining scene reflects the city's extraordinary cultural diversity, with Pacific Rim cuisine standing at the forefront. The city's Pacific Island and Asian communities have created a vibrant street food culture, while the proximity to pristine waters means exceptional seafood is a constant highlight. New Zealand's world-class produce — from Bluff oysters to Canterbury lamb and Marlborough wine — elevates Auckland's fine dining to international standards.
Must-Try Dishes
These iconic dishes define the culinary identity of Auckland.
Bluff Oysters
The world's finest oysters from the deep cold waters of Foveaux Strait, available fresh in Auckland restaurants during the May-August season
Kumara (Sweet Potato)
New Zealand's beloved root vegetable prepared in dozens of ways; Māori kumara is richer and more flavourful than imported varieties
Paua (Abalone)
New Zealand's endemic giant abalone, a Māori delicacy with an intense oceanic flavour, often served in fritters or with butter
Hangi
Traditional Māori cooking method using heated rocks in an underground pit, producing succulent slow-cooked meats and vegetables with a unique earthy flavour
Fish and Chips
New Zealand's most beloved takeaway — battered snapper or tarakihi served with chips. Auckland's proximity to the sea ensures exceptionally fresh fish

Top Restaurants
Our handpicked recommendations for the best dining experiences.
The French Café
Consistently rated among Auckland's very best restaurants, The French Café offers an exquisite tasting menu showcasing New Zealand's finest seasonal ingredients prepared with classical French technique. Chef Simon Wright's kitchen has earned numerous awards and the restaurant is essential dining for serious food lovers.
Clooney
An intimate, design-forward fine dining restaurant offering creative contemporary cuisine in an elegant setting. Chef Tony Stewart crafts imaginative seasonal menus that push culinary boundaries while remaining deeply connected to New Zealand's exceptional produce.
Harbourside Ocean Bar Grill
Perched above the Ferry Building with breathtaking harbour views, Harbourside serves the finest New Zealand seafood in one of the city's most spectacular settings. The menu focuses on sustainable New Zealand fish, oysters, and shellfish alongside premium meats.
Depot Eatery & Oyster Bar
Chef Al Brown's acclaimed no-reservations restaurant is one of Auckland's most beloved eating experiences, offering fresh New Zealand seafood and honest comfort food in a lively, communal setting. The raw bar featuring Bluff oysters and Cloudy Bay clams is unmissable.
O'Connell Street Bistro
A beloved institution in Auckland's CBD, O'Connell Street Bistro has been delivering exceptional modern New Zealand cuisine for over two decades. The elegant bistro setting, outstanding wine list, and consistently superb food make it a perennial favourite for business lunches and special occasions.
Ahi
Chef Ben Bayly's flagship restaurant in the Britomart precinct celebrates New Zealand's extraordinary food produce with a creative and deeply personal menu. The intimate dining room and exceptional service create a memorable experience showcasing kai Māori concepts.
Baduzzi
Auckland's finest Italian restaurant brings the soul of Italy to the Wynyard Quarter waterfront. Chef Michael Dearth sources outstanding New Zealand ingredients and imports the finest Italian produce to create authentic, deeply satisfying Italian cuisine.
Orphans Kitchen
A Ponsonby institution with a fervent local following, Orphans Kitchen is committed to nose-to-tail and root-to-leaf cooking using organic and biodynamic producers. The relaxed, plant-filled dining room and natural wine list create an authentic neighbourhood restaurant experience.

Street Food & Markets
The best local flavors at affordable prices.
Hangi kai
Traditional Māori earth-oven cooked meats and vegetables
Pacific Island food
Samoan chop suey, Tongan umu-cooked meats, Niuean dishes
Asian food truck fare
Rotating selection of Vietnamese, Korean, Japanese, and Chinese dishes
Food Markets
La Cigale French Market
Auckland's most beloved market with French-inspired produce, artisan goods, and superb café
Otara Flea Market
Vibrant Pacific community market with ethnic food, produce, and crafts
Grey Lynn Farmers Market
Excellent local produce market in a charming inner-city park
Clevedon Village Farmers Market
Outstanding rural market 45 minutes from Auckland with exceptional artisan produce
Dining Etiquette & Tips
Navigate the local food scene like a pro.
Auckland restaurants are typically busy from 7PM Thursday-Saturday; book ahead
No-reservations restaurants like Depot require patience but are worth the wait
Auckland has outstanding Asian cuisine reflecting its diverse Pacific population
Ponsonby Road is best explored by foot; drive to Parnell for fine dining
Service charges are not automatically added in Auckland; round up the bill or tip 10% for excellent service
